Explore Blue Lake’s Top Attractions

  • Blue Lake Park: Discover the beauty of Blue Lake, California at this picturesque park where you can enjoy a peaceful stroll or a cozy picnic amidst lush greenery, making it an ideal backdrop for romantic wedding photos.

  • Humboldt Botanical Gardens: Just a short drive away from Blue Lake, the Humboldt Botanical Gardens features stunning native plants and breathtaking views that create a serene environment perfect for couples looking to celebrate their love in nature.

  • Lost Man Creek Trail: Embark on an enchanting hike along the Lost Man Creek Trail, where you can experience the lush forests and tranquil waters, providing a picturesque setting for couples seeking adventure before their wedding celebration.

  • Mad River Beach County Park: Enjoy a day by the ocean at Mad River Beach, located near Blue Lake, where you can walk hand-in-hand along the sandy shore, offering a romantic escape before or after your wedding festivities.

  • Sequoia Park Zoo: Visit the charming Sequoia Park Zoo in Eureka, just a short drive from Blue Lake, where you can explore intriguing animal exhibits and enjoy a fun, lighthearted day with loved ones leading up to your wedding.

  • Eureka Historic Old Town: Stroll through the delightful streets of Eureka's Historic Old Town, rich with Victorian architecture and unique shops, providing a lovely atmosphere to capture memorable moments on your wedding weekend.

  • Redwood National and State Parks: Immerse yourself in the awe-inspiring beauty of Redwood National and State Parks, where towering trees and scenic landscapes offer a breathtaking setting for intimate wedding ceremonies surrounded by nature.

  • Clam Beach County Park: Just a short trip from Blue Lake, Clam Beach County Park invites you to relax on its pristine sands, where you can bask in the sun or take a romantic walk while planning your dream wedding by the sea.

Blue Lake Frequently Asked Questions

The best months for a wedding in Blue Lake are typically late spring through early fall, particularly from May to September. During this time, you can enjoy comfortable weather and beautiful natural scenery.

To get married in Blue Lake you need to obtain a marriage license from any California county clerk's office. Both parties must be present, and identification is required, along with a fee for the license.
